While cleaning the cooktop with Easy Off oven cleaner, I accidentally got overspray on the raised vent cap. The finish appears to be damaged. I used water, then Hadco Stainless Steel polish, then Cerama Brite stainless steel polish to try to clean it, but there are still spots on the vent cap. Can anything be used to clean this, or does the vent cap need to be replaced? If it needs replaced, is it an easy job?
